iVC Emulsifying Gel Cream Developed by Seiwa Kasei
Ingredients
%

Phase A

  • Amitose GCA (Seiwa Kasei)
  • 0.63
  • Butylene glycol
  • 1.37
  • Glycerin
  • 6.00

Phase B

  • Caprylic/Capric triglyceride
  • 10.00

Phase C

  • Water
  • 10.00

Phase D

  • Butylene Glycol
  • 6.00
  • Disodium EDTA
  • 0.02
  • Water
  • Up to 100.00

Phase E

  • Polyacrylate crosspolymer-6
  • 1.20
  • Xanthan Gum
  • 0.20

Procedure

Mix A and stir with a paddle at 300 rpm. Add B to 1) in 10 additions stirring with a paddle at 300 rpm and stir at 300 rpm for 10 minutes. Add C to 2) slowly stirring with a paddle at 300 rpm and stir at 300 rpm for 10 minutes. Add E to D (stirring 6,000 rpm), and stir with a disper mixer (6,000 rpm, 3 minutes). Add 3) to 4) slowly stirring with a paddle at 300 rpm and stir at 300 rpm for 3 minutes.

Properties

pH 4.0-5.0 (25°C). Viscosity 20,000 – 40,000 mPa•s (25°C Brookfield viscometer No. 4, 12 rpm). This formulation is stable for two months under the condition of 0°C, 25°C and 50°C.
